. Source: A DNA sequence encoding the mature mouse sFRP-3 protein sequence Ala33-Ser323 was fused to a 6X histidine tag at the carboxy-terminus. The fusion protein was expressed in a mouse myeloma cell line, NS0. Swiss/UniProt Accession: P97401. Molecular Mass: Based on N-terminal sequencing, the mature mouse sFRP-3 protein starts at Ala33 and has a calculated molecular mass of 34kD. As a result of glycosylation, the recombinant protein migrates as an ~37kD protein in SDS-PAGE under reducing conditions. Activity: Measured by its ability to inhibit proliferation in MC3T3-E1 mouse preosteoblast cells. ED 50 1.5-6.0 ug/mL. Endotoxin : <1.0 EU per 1 ug (LAL)

products description :
Secreted Frizzled Related Protein 3 (sFRP-3) was originally identified in bovine cartilage for its chondrogenic ability. Human, mouse, chick and Xenopus clones have also been isolated. sFRP-3 is often referred to as FRZB, other names also include Fritz, Frzb1, and FRP-3. At the amino acid sequence level, sFRP-3 is highly conserved. The mouse protein shares 76% identity with Xenopus, and 92% with human proteins. The gene for mouse sFRP-3 has been localized to the central region of chromosome 2. Murine sFRP-3 is expressed in the primitive streak during gastrulation, as well as in the retina, foregut diverticulum, nervous system, and posterior mesoderm during development. In adult tissues, sFRP-3 expression, as determined by Northern blot, is detected in the heart, brain, spleen, skeletal muscle, kidney and testis. The N-terminal portion of sFRP-3 protein shows 50% amino acid identity to the corresponding region of the Drosophila frizzled gene product, a receptor for Wg/Wnt signals. The similarity of sFRP-3 with frizzled proteins is restricted to the N-terminal cysteine-rich domain (CRD) that contains at least ten cysteine residues with highly conserved spacing between them. sFRP-3 was subsequently shown to be a soluble antagonist of Wnt signals. It lacks all transmembrane domains of frizzled proteins but retains the ability to bind Wnts. Ectopic expression of sFRP-3 mRNA has been shown to interfere with the induction of secondary axes in Xenopus embryos injected with Xwnt-8 mRNA (Hoang et al., 1996, J. Biol. Chem. 271:26131; Leyns et al., 1997, Cell 88:747;

ncbi summary :
The protein encoded by this gene is a secreted protein that is involved in the regulation of bone development. Defects in this gene are a cause of female-specific osteoarthritis (OA) susceptibility. [provided by RefSeq, Apr 2010]
uniprot summary :
FRZB: Soluble frizzled-related proteins (sFRPS) function as modulators of Wnt signaling through direct interaction with Wnts. They have a role in regulating cell growth and differentiation in specific cell types. SFRP3/FRZB appears to be involved in limb skeletogenesis. Antagonist of Wnt8 signaling. Regulates chondrocyte maturation and long bone development. Defects in FRZB are associated with susceptibility to osteoarthritis type 1(OS1). Osteoarthritis is a degenerative disease of the joints characterized by degradation of the hyaline articular cartilage and remodeling of the subchondral bone with sclerosis. Clinical symptoms include pain and joint stiffness often leading to significant disability and joint replacement. Belongs to the secreted frizzled-related protein (sFRP) family.
